Detailed 12-Week Course Layout

WeekModule & Key Topics
Weeks 1-2Fundamentals of Machinery: Machine elements, power transmission (shafts, gears, belts, chains), prime movers, fluid & pneumatic power systems.
Week 3Wire Ropes & Site Prep: Steel wire rope design/maintenance, rock-tool interaction, dozers, rippers.
Weeks 4-5Surface Mining - Cyclic Excavation: Drills, scrapers, motor graders, electric rope shovels, hydraulic excavators, front-end loaders.
Week 6Surface Mining - Continuous Excavation: Bucket wheel excavators, bucket chain excavators, continuous surface miners, dredges.
Weeks 7-8Underground Mining Machinery: Loaders (LHD, SDL), road headers, continuous miners, shearers, shuttle cars, and coal handling plants.
Week 9Turbo & Transport (Surface): Pumps, fans, compressors; off-highway trucks, belt conveyors.
Weeks 10-11Transport (Underground): Aerial ropeways, rope haulage, locomotives, cage and skip winding systems.
Week 12Special Equipment & Maintenance: Low-profile dumpers, introduction to maintenance engineering principles and strategies.
